Sundowns move 7 points closer to title thanks to Shalulile’s hat-trick

Mamelodi Sundowns striker Peter Shalulile scored his second consecutive hat-trick as the Brazilians defeated Golden Arrows 6-0 at the Loftus Versfeld on Tuesday afternoon.

Sundowns have increased their DStv Premiership points lead as they are now on 57 points.

The Brazilians have a 14-point lead over second-place Royal AM.

Mamelodi Sundowns’ Uruguayan-born midfielder Gaston Sirino, striker Pavol Safranko and Kermit Erasmus also added their names to the scoresheet.

Shalulile took his tally to 21 goals for the season.

Sundowns have five games left to play.

The defending champions only need only six points to wrap up the league title.
